[Tip: Place the Demon Egg in a suitable nursery environment to enter the taming process. Different Demons have different incubation times. After the Demon is born, provide materials to the nursery and it will generate the most suitable growth resources for them.]Li Ang looked at the so-called "nursery environment" reflected as separate panels for each area on the interface.

The world beneath his feet expanded to a certain extent and then stopped changing. The nursery interface displayed clear regions like the [Forest Area], [Aquatic Area], [Wilderness Area], [Cloud Mist Area], and [Volcanic Area].

Each area had a slot for nurturing Demons, and to add more slots, these areas needed to be expanded, which would require adding some materials. However, this time the materials were not as abstract as building a nursery, but rather regular magic materials.

Once the panel was open, all Li Ang had to do was pick up a Demon Egg, and the system listed the corresponding materials needed for nurturing the Demon. For instance, for the Salamander Egg, the system suggested rare fire attribute materials such as Slow Burning Fire Stone and Life Lava, which could create environments and food that fire salamanders preferred when placed in the nursery.

But Li Ang was a bit puzzled. The value of these materials alone might exceed the value gained from hunting a Salamander. Could the benefits of nurturing a Salamander this way outweigh the materials used?

This point was not easy to prove with the Salamander because he did not have such good fire attribute materials at hand.

He turned his attention to the other Demon Eggs he had.

Along his journey, based on his adventures, he’d collected different Demon Eggs. The Sea Dragon Egg was the most suitable, but due to the accident on Mengze Island, it eventually led to Livi’s birth. Excluding the Salamander, only the Whiteflower Wasp and Fairy Dragon remained.

These two were heavyweights, innately filled with a desire for slaughter, making them good candidates for testing the system’s monster taming functionality.

Li Ang pondered for a moment and ultimately chose the Fairy Dragon, not for any other reason than group acceptance. Although he thought the chitinous shell of the Whiteflower Wasp was quite stylish, all the young girls, aside from Andasu, expressed their concerns about him taming the Whiteflower Wasp.

As soon as Li Ang picked up the Fairy Dragon Egg, he received a system prompt.

[Selected Object: Fairy Dragon Egg. Suitable Nurturing Environments: Forest Area, Aquatic Area, Cloud Mist Area. Suggested Choice: Forest Area.]

Li Ang headed toward the forest, and Farina, who was deep in thought, followed him.

The nursery’s forest wasn’t vast, but the lowest level plants in the jungle had already grown between the tree trunks. Various sizes of leaves covered the land, and some trees had mysteriously collapsed and decayed, sprouting large patches of mushrooms, with some Clear Springs emerging from the ground.

"If I hadn’t seen it with my own eyes and you told me this was the cabin of the Eternal Summer, I wouldn’t believe it. It just feels like you’ve teleported me to the Giant Garden," Farina said.

The Giant Garden is an island that specializes in nurturing Demons. The rulers of the island are the Campbell Clan, the family from which Dorothy hails.

It has a wild environment difficult to develop and was once a poor place, but the current lord obtained a Secret Technique for nurturing Demons in his youth, turning the island into a privileged breeding ground for monsters.

Farina used to go there a lot to find suitable food for her Dragons, which is why she said this.

"I didn’t expect it either."

Li Ang could only attribute it to the Ancient Secret Technique.

Following the system’s guidance, he found the "nurturing slot" in the forest.

It was an environment surrounded by Clear Springs, flowers, vines, fruits, and mushrooms. The bird songs in the forest were not background noise, but rather creatures of unknown origin, perhaps created similarly to the magical monsters from the Magical Disaster.

In this space combining various forest elements, there was a large herbaceous plant. Its leaves and soft yellow petals were wide and soft, like a soft mattress covered with dew, overlapping one another, seemingly able to hide small animals.

Just looking at it, he felt it was very suitable for the Fairy Dragon to grow on.

Li Ang took out a Fairy Dragon Egg, resembling iridescent jelly, and placed it on the yellow plant.

After selecting to confirm taming on the system interface, the yellow flower bed shook slightly, birthing a stream of natural magic that connected with the entire forest. As the magic pulsed, the whole forest seemed to "breathe" in unison, with the water mist, gentle breeze, and swaying plants falling into the same rhythm.

When the entire forest’s rhythm synchronized, natural magic suddenly infused the Fairy Dragon Egg, integrating it as a part of this environment.

And this entire environment existed because of Li Ang.

He couldn’t explain the principles behind it, but he could feel the whole space was linked to him, especially the Fairy Dragon Egg.

Now, he stood in a special position, at the apex of a systematic structure, with the capability to control various veins of this system with just a single hand, not to mention the Fairy Dragon within it.

The mere sense of this control made him feel that he’d reached a level beyond the normal individuals of Nebis.

Li Ang was certain he could control the Fairy Dragon born from the nursery, but instead of immediately feeling happy, he found himself momentarily speechless.

It was as if explained by the Dunning-Kruger Effect curve. When he stepped into the Excellence Realm, catching a glimpse of the blurry phantom of the world’s truth, he instead developed a greater reverence for the world itself.
